With the rapid growth of complex therapeutic formulations such as biologics, monoclonal antibodies (mAbs), gene therapies, and advanced animal health vaccines across rural and urban Ireland, traditional glass or standard polypropylene syringes often fall short. They face challenges ranging from high siliconization levels triggering protein aggregation to high dead volume causing unacceptable product loss of costly formulations.

Our next-generation syringe bodies use Cyclo-Olefin Polymer (COP) and Cyclo-Olefin Copolymer (COC), exhibiting exceptional glass-like clarity, high impact resistance, and an extremely low extractables profile, protecting delicate biological drug structures from degradation.
By integrating optimized hub geometry and highly precise plunger-to-tip matching, our dosage systems reduce waste to less than 0.002 mL. This results in significant cost savings when administering high-cost modern biologics.
To combat sub-visible particulate generation, we offer customized low-silicone and cross-linked siliconization options, minimizing the risk of protein interaction while ensuring extremely smooth gliding forces for auto-injector integration.
Understanding material dynamics is crucial for Ireland's drug delivery engineers. Below is a comparative overview of JZCare's high-precision dosage material classes compared to baseline market standards.
| Parameters | Standard Polypropylene (PP) | JZCare Medical COP Syringes | Borosilicate Glass Syringes |
|---|---|---|---|
| Clarity & Light Transmission | Moderate (Slight Haze) | Excellent (>92%) | Excellent (>92%) |
| Extractables & Leachables | Low (Contains organic additives) | Extremely Low (Pure carbon chain) | Extremely Low (Potential heavy metals/alkali) |
| Impact & Fracture Resistance | High | Extremely High (Durable) | Low (Brittle, high risk of breakage) |
| Siliconization requirement | High (To lower break-loose force) | Ultra-low / Custom baked | Mandatory (Increases particulate risks) |
| LDS Optimization | Standard | Optimized LDS Hub Design available | Standard fixed needle hub |

Navigating the regulatory landscape of the EU is a significant challenge for healthcare brands, clinicians, and researchers in Ireland. Under the EU Medical Device Regulation (MDR 2017/745), traceability, cleanroom validation, and biocompatibility profiles are subject to intense scrutiny.
Hangzhou JZCare Medical Co., Ltd. operates with total compliance transparency. Our manufacturing workflows are certified under ISO 13485:2016 quality management systems. Every batch of our high-precision syringes is produced inside class 100,000 (ISO Class 8) positive-pressure cleanroom environments to minimize airborne particulate and biological burden. Our sterilization protocols conform to ISO 11135 (Ethylene Oxide sterilization) and ISO 11137 (Gamma irradiation), ensuring every single unit delivered to Irish ports is completely sterile, pyrogen-free, and non-toxic.
All fluid-contact raw materials undergo rigorous testing based on USP Class VI and ISO 10993 standards (including cytotoxicity, sensitization, systemic toxicity, and hemocompatibility). Chemical characterization studies are documented in our Drug Master File (DMF), which is available to support Irish pharmaceutical brands during NDA or clinical trial applications.

Autoinjector integration demands extremely tight tolerances. Standard injection-molded barrels often have minute variations that can lead to assembly issues during automated high-speed packaging. JZCare's manufacturing process incorporates inline vision systems that measure inner and outer diameters at micron levels, ensuring smooth plunger travel and zero jam occurrences.
